Aust dollar slips in early trade
Local currency lowers ahead of US Federal Reserve meeting this week.
The Australian dollar is lower as investors await the outcome of the US Federal Reserve meeting later in the week.
At 0630 AEDT, the local unit was trading at 95.86 US cents, down from 96.05 cents on Friday.
On Wednesday (US time), the US central bank's policy committee will finish its two-day meeting, where a decision on winding up its economic stimulus program is expected to be made.
